The automotive mapping transformation continues.
Today, Google Maps navigation engine is decoupled from Google's Maps UI for automotive. OEMs can finally use their own HMI, and use Google data for deep integrations.
Recently, ChatGPT joined Bing to offer tourism guides.
HERE rearchitected format into UniMap for flexible aggregation and distribution.
TomTom & multiple Big Tech firms formed Overture Maps Foundation for open data and AI sharing.
Google, Microsoft, HERE and TomTom all have long involvement in digital mapping, but what aspects of their newest endeavors will last the 11 year average lifespan of a car? How will OEMs, tier 1 and tier 2 navigation providers respond?
